Course Title | Code | Semester | L+U Hour | Credits | ECTS |
---|---|---|---|---|---|
Web Design and Internet Programming | YBS212 | 4. Semester | 3 + 0 | 3.0 | 6.0 |
Prerequisites | None |
Language of Instruction | Turkish |
Course Level | Undergraduate |
Course Type | |
Mode of delivery | Distance based/FaceToFace |
Course Coordinator |
Assist. Prof. Dr. Ali AKAYTAY |
Instructors |
Ali AKAYTAY |
Assistants | |
Goals | Understanding the basic features of the internet, designing the internet site and learning various technologies used in internet programming. |
Course Content | Learning the concepts of web world, web site design, publishing and programming |
Learning Outcomes |
- Gains knowledge about the history of the Internet, its infrastructure and concepts related to the web world. - Have knowledge about web technologies such as HTML, CSS, Javascript, BooStrap etc..and can design web page by using these tehcnologies - Gains knowledge of the stages of publishing a locally made website and publishes it. - Can convert a static website to dynamic using web programming technologies. |
Week | Topics | Learning Methods |
---|---|---|
1. Week | Internet and Web concepts, infrastructure | Practice Course Hours Preparation, After Class Study |
2. Week | Web Page Design and Basic Rules | Course Hours Practice Preparation, After Class Study |
3. Week | Basic HTML Codes | Course Hours Preparation, After Class Study Practice |
4. Week | HTML, Working with Tables, Working with Forms, | Course Hours Preparation, After Class Study Practice |
5. Week | Content formatting with CSS | Course Hours Preparation, After Class Study Practice |
6. Week | Working with Forms, Using Multimedia Components | Practice Course Hours Preparation, After Class Study |
7. Week | BootStrap | Course Hours Preparation, After Class Study Practice |
8. Week | Bootstrap | |
9. Week | Basics of Javascript | Preparation, After Class Study Practice Course Hours |
10. Week | Arrays, loops and functions in Javascript | Practice Preparation, After Class Study Course Hours |
11. Week | Javascript Object Literals | Practice Preparation, After Class Study Course Hours |
12. Week | Loops in Javascript | Course Hours Practice Preparation, After Class Study |
13. Week | Current features in Javascript | Preparation, After Class Study Practice Course Hours |
14. Week | Homework Presentations | Course Hours Practice Preparation, After Class Study |
https://www.w3schools.com/ |
https://developer.mozilla.org/ |
Program Requirements | Contribution Level | DK1 | DK2 | DK3 | DK4 | Measurement Method |
---|---|---|---|---|---|---|
PY1 | 1 | 0 | 0 | 0 | 0 | - |
PY2 | 5 | 5 | 5 | 5 | 5 | - |
PY3 | 4 | 4 | 4 | 4 | 4 | - |
PY4 | 3 | 3 | 3 | 3 | 3 | - |
PY5 | 3 | 3 | 3 | 3 | 3 | - |
PY6 | 3 | 3 | 3 | 3 | 3 | - |
PY7 | 4 | 4 | 4 | 4 | 4 | - |
PY8 | 2 | 2 | 2 | 2 | 2 | - |
PY9 | 4 | 4 | 4 | 4 | 4 | - |
PY10 | 3 | 3 | 3 | 3 | 3 | - |
PY11 | 1 | 1 | 1 | 1 | 1 | - |
PY12 | 2 | 2 | 2 | 2 | 2 | - |
PY13 | 1 | 1 | 1 | 1 | 1 | - |
PY14 | 1 | 1 | 1 | 1 | 1 | - |
0 | 1 | 2 | 3 | 4 | 5 | |
---|---|---|---|---|---|---|
Course's Level of contribution | None | Very Low | Low | Fair | High | Very High |
Method of assessment/evaluation | Written exam | Oral Exams | Assignment/Project | Laboratory work | Presentation/Seminar |
Event | Quantity | Duration (Hour) | Total Workload (Hour) |
---|---|---|---|
Course Hours | 14 | 3 | 42 |
Research | 14 | 3 | 42 |
Homework 1 | 1 | 40 | 40 |
Final | 1 | 1 | 1 |
Practice | 14 | 2 | 28 |
Total Workload | 153 | ||
ECTS Credit of the Course | 6.0 |